Location: Remote Northern Communities (BC, AB, MB, ON, Nunavut)

Assignment Duration: 2–6 weeks

Pay: $60/hour + $22/hour non-taxed Northern Allowance

The Work You Will Do

  • Work in a team atmosphere performing an expanded scope of practice in communities, providing primary and emergency care to all residents –from newborn to elders –through a nursing station / Health Center in a clinic atmosphere
  • Utilize the skills of observation, assessment, nursing diagnosis, counseling, and health teaching according to care plan
  • Health Promotion, Assessments, planning and implementing care using Best Practice Clinical Practice Guidelines; primary care and emergency care; travel nursing; experience creating care plans; IPAC and communicable disease control, immunizations
  • Ensure that, on an ongoing basis, the emotional, spiritual, physical comfort and safety of clients are met to the greatest possible extent within the scope of practice

Who You Are

  • You are a graduate from an accredited School of Nursing and have a nursing license through the governing body in good standing
  • You are a licensed Nurse registered in good standing
  • You have or are willing to obtain a nursing license through the regulating body in the provinces or territories you wish to work
  • You meet the required work experience
  • Mandatory skillsets and additional training requirements and reimbursements will be discussed during interview
